What Is an Errata Sheet?



An errata sheet is a vital device in legal services paperwork, offering modifications to mistakes determined in formerly published materials. You could experience it in contracts, briefs, or various other lawful files where precision is crucial. Essentially, an errata sheet notes particular mistakes and their corrections, guaranteeing clarity and precision in the lawful language made use of.


When you find a mistake, you'll desire to resolve it promptly to keep professionalism and trustworthiness. An errata sheet aids you connect these modifications to all pertinent events, minimizing confusion and potential conflicts. It's not just a basic correction; it represents your commitment to preserving high criteria in your lawful documents.

Ideal Practices for Implementing Errata Sheets



To ensure quality and precision in legal paperwork, carrying out errata sheets successfully is necessary. Beginning by plainly labeling the errata sheet appropriately, ensuring it's quickly recognizable. Consist of a brief intro that details the function of the file, so everybody recognizes its significance.


Next, list each mistake systematically, supplying the original message along with the remedied variation. This style assists readers promptly grasp the adjustments. Ensure to date the errata sheet and include the names of those accountable for the modifications, promoting responsibility.


Distribute the errata sheet to all celebrations included in the paperwork, and consider incorporating it into the initial file for simple referral. Ultimately, keep documents of all errata sheets for future compliance checks. Is There a Conventional Style for an Errata Sheet?



There isn't a global typical format for an errata sheet, however it normally consists of headings, a clear list of improvements, and references to specific web pages. You should follow any certain standards appropriate to your jurisdiction.


Can Several Errata Sheets Be Provided for the Very Same Paper?



Yes, you can release multiple errata sheets for the same record. Each sheet addresses different errors or updates, making certain that all improvements are clearly interacted and documented, preserving the paper's precision and honesty throughout its use.
